How to Get a Mental Health Assessment

If you or someone you know is struggling, it could be beneficial to have an assessment for mental health. It's important to keep in mind that each person is responsible for their own treatment.

It can be frightening to think that you may have a mental illness, and it's normal to be anxious about seeking assistance. With patience, hope and support, you can overcome these feelings and get an assessment of your mental health.


What is an assessment of mental health?

A mental health assessment is an informal conversation between you and a mental health professional in order to determine the kind of support you require. The mental health professional will employ an integrated approach to assessing your needs as well as your lifestyle, your cultural background and beliefs, as well as how they might impact your mood or feelings. You'll need to be honest and transparent during the examination to help the mental health professional understand your situation. They will ask questions about your past experiences, current symptoms and how long you've been experiencing them for. They will also evaluate how well you can work as a team, interact with others and manage your emotions. You might be asked to discuss your feelings using images, music, or art, drama, play therapy or electronic assessment tools. They could also take formal tests to determine conditions such as depression anxiety or PTSD. ADHD or attention deficit disorder.

The mental health assessment will consist of a physical examination as well as a psychological examination. During the physical exam, your doctor will note your general appearance and behavior, as well as your levels of alertness and consciousness. You will be asked about your family's medical history, and if you're currently taking any medication. If they suspect you may be suffering from a neurological disorder, they'll likely order laboratory tests, including urine analysis and blood tests. They may also order MRIs or CT scans.

During a psychological evaluation Your doctor will interview you in a non-structured or structured way to gather information about your feelings and you. They will inquire about how your symptoms affect your daily life, if they have gotten worse or better and what factors cause them worse or better. They will ask about your family and childhood, your relationships, your work, and any major events that could have affected your symptoms.

The mental health assessment is the initial step in the process of diagnosing the presence of a mental illness. The assessment can be performed in person, by telephone or online. It helps connect with a mental healthcare provider who can help manage your symptoms. It is crucial to take a mental assessment as soon as possible in order to get the treatment you require and to begin treatment.

What happens during a mental health assessment?

The person who is conducting the examination, for example psychiatrists, psychiatric nurses, will ask you questions about your mental problems and how they affect you. They will also look you over and take notes. Remember that this process was designed to assist you.

Your medical history will be reviewed as well as your family history of mental health conditions. They will also examine any traumatic events you have experienced in your life as they could be linked to your mental health issues.

You will be asked questions about your mental health, how you manage it, and how the symptoms impact you at work, at home, or in social situations. They may ask you questions about your relationships, or stressors in your life. They will also inquire about any medication you are taking, whether prescribed or not. They may also want know about any other health issues you have, such as thyroid problems or an injury.

A doctor or psychiatrist will conduct a basic physical exam as part of the examination to make sure that your symptoms are not caused by something else. They might need to conduct laboratory tests like urine and blood tests. If your doctor suspects you are suffering from a neurologic issue then he or she could also order an CT scanner or an MRI.

It is essential that you are honest with the specialists who will be conducting the evaluation. They need to understand the entire picture in order to determine if you are suffering from. They may be able help you find a plan of treatment that is beneficial for you.

If you are in a crisis, your physician will likely locate an emergency room as soon as possible after assessing. You should be prepared to be admitted if required, and this will depend on where you are and if there is a bed that is suitable. Speak to the manager if you feel your assessment isn't being considered seriously or you aren't getting the support and care you require. If this isn't possible then ask an additional mental health professional to give you an opinion.

What is the purpose for an evaluation of mental health?

It's normal to feel low and anxious at times. However, if your symptoms persist and affect your daily life it is recommended that you consult an expert. A mental health assessment is when a psychiatrist or psychologist examines the symptoms of mental illness.

Doctors can test their patients for mental disorders using simple screening questions, questionnaires like the Kessler Psychological Distress Scale or My Mood Monitor Checklist. The mental health assessment is typically a series of questions about how the symptoms are impacting the person's life as well as their ability to think and remember, as well as their relationships with other people. They will also inquire about how long the symptoms have been present and if they have any relatives with a history of mental illness. They may also inquire about the use of alcohol or drugs and whether the symptoms have changed.

A medical or mental health professional will conduct a physical exam and request any necessary lab tests to rule out a medical cause for the issue. They will take note of the individual's story and evaluate their interactions with others and their behavior in everyday situations.

When conducting a mental health evaluation the psychiatrist or psychologist will speak to the person about their symptoms, how they affect their life and what they have attempted to overcome the symptoms. They will also ask about their previous experiences with depression, anxiety or other mental illnesses, and about any medication they're taking.

It is important to bring an amiable family member or friend with you during the examination. They can provide support and encouragement. Some people feel more comfortable discussing their mental health when they have an experienced and trusted family member with them. If someone is a young person or has suicidal thoughts, they may require additional support to get help.

How can I get an assessment of my mental health?

Like you visit the doctor for a regular check-up, if there are concerns about your mental health, you can speak to your family physician or a psychologist. They will recommend you to a specialist or you can make the appointment yourself. You can also request a mental health assessment by making contact with your local NHS trust and soliciting an appointment.

The majority of psychiatric examinations start with a consultation. During this time the doctor will inquire about your symptoms and the length of time they have been present. They will also ask you about your family history, as well as any other relevant details.

The interview will be conducted either in person or via the phone. The specialist will take notes while they listen to your story. They will then assess your needs and provide recommendations for treatment. This will help them decide which service on the mental health continuum will best cater to your needs, whether that is outpatient or inpatient.

Certain psychiatric tests may include physical examination. This is because certain physical ailments, such as thyroid disorders or neurological issues, can cause symptoms that resemble mental illnesses. A physical exam can also aid the psychiatrist in determining whether you are taking any medications. This includes over-the-counter and natural supplements.

You can take an online mental health assessment to assess the severity of your symptoms. These tests can help you recognize early warning signs and connect you with mental health services. They can also be useful for families and employers of people with mental health conditions.

There are community support groups for people suffering from mental illness that can offer an appointment with specialists. Some of these groups can be located by searching for a group in your area. Other groups can be found through your local council or GP.
